I just ordered a pair of Japanese flats from Japan and received them today. Your going to end up spending close to 200 dollars with shipping but if you have wide feet and are disenchanted by the ridiculous moon shoe minimalist footwear the US market offers...
That is the portal to access different merchants who sell flats. Once you've found what you've wanted you'll have to set up a forwarding address with Tenso.com which will forward the package to your US address.
I don't speak Japanese but the process was fairly painless. The service was reliable and the merchant was in contact with me through every step of the process. You'll have to rely on Google translate quite a bit and if that doesn't help you to understand you can post the e-mail you need help translating to Yahoo! answers and someone will help you out. I was lucky to have some of my questions answered by an American who lived in Japan who also uses Rakuten.
